Jean-Pierre Danguillaume (born 25 May 1946) is a retired French professional road bicycle racer. His sporting career began with U.C. Joue. Between 1970 and 1978, Danguillaume won 7 stages in the Tour de France. He also competed in the team time trial at the 1968 Summer Olympics.
